The DPDP Act is no longer optional
The Digital Personal Data Protection Act, 2023 became operational when the DPDP Rules, 2025 were notified on 13 November 2025. Notice, consent, data-principal rights, breach reporting and security safeguards become mandatory from 13 May 2027.

Does the DPDP Act apply to my small business?
Yes. Any organisation that collects personal data from Indian residents — even through a single web form or a WhatsApp Business chat — is a Data Fiduciary under the Act. Size does not exempt you, though it affects how heavy your obligations are.
What is the actual deadline?
The DPDP Rules were notified on 13 November 2025 with an 18-month phase-in. Full compliance — notice, consent, data-principal rights, breach reporting and security safeguards — is expected from 13 May 2027. Building the documentation now is far cheaper than retrofitting later.
